2016

Mexico participated in the 2016 event at Lee Valley VeloPark in London, United Kingdom from 2–4 March 2016. A team of 6 cyclists (4 women, 2 men) was announced to represent the country in the event.[4][5]

Results

Men

Name Event Result Rank
Ignacio Prado Men's scratch 2
